01Understanding the Ketogenic Diet: Benefits and How it Works

The ketogenic diet, or keto for short, has been making waves in the health and wellness world. It's a diet that's high in fat, moderate in protein, and low in carbohydrates. But before you start picturing a plate full of bacon and cheese, let's dive into the science behind it. The body typically uses glucose, derived from carbohydrates, as its primary source of energy. However, when you drastically reduce your carbohydrate intake, your body enters a metabolic state known as ketosis. Think of your body as a car engine. Normally, it runs on gasoline (glucose), but when gasoline runs low, it switches to using diesel (fat) instead. In the state of ketosis, your body becomes incredibly efficient at burning fat for energy. It also turns fat into ketones in the liver, which can supply energy for the brain. The ketogenic diet is not just about weight loss, although that's one of the most significant benefits. It's also about improving your overall health. The diet can lead to a reduction in blood sugar and insulin levels, which can be particularly beneficial for people with diabetes or prediabetes. Other potential health benefits include improved heart health due to increased levels of 'good' HDL cholesterol, lower blood pressure, and improved brain function. Now, let's address some common misconceptions about the ketogenic diet. First, eating fat doesn't necessarily make you fat. When your body is in a state of ketosis, it's burning fat for energy, not storing it. Second, the ketogenic diet is not a high-protein diet. It's a high-fat, moderate-protein, low-carb diet. Consuming too much protein can actually prevent your body from entering ketosis. If you're considering starting the ketogenic diet, here are some practical tips. Plan your meals ahead of time and prepare them at home to ensure you're consuming the right amounts of fats, proteins, and carbs. Stay hydrated and get plenty of sleep, as both are crucial for overall health and weight loss. Gradually reduce your carbohydrate intake to help your body adjust to the new diet. And remember, not all fats are created equal. Opt for high-quality fats like avocados, nuts, and seeds, and avoid processed foods as much as possible. In conclusion, the ketogenic diet is more than just a diet; it's a lifestyle change. It's about making conscious choices about what you eat and understanding how those choices affect your body. So, if you're looking for a way to lose weight, improve your health, and feel more energetic, the ketogenic diet might be worth considering.

02Your 21-day guide to starting a keto diet

Starting a new diet can feel like stepping into uncharted territory. It's a journey filled with potential pitfalls, from figuring out what to eat, to dealing with cravings, to staying motivated. But fear not, taco, tortilla, and tequila lovers! Chiquis Rivera's book, "Chiquis Keto: The 21-Day Starter Kit for Taco, Tortilla, and Tequila Lovers," is here to guide you through the wilderness of the ketogenic diet. The ketogenic, or keto, diet is a low-carb, high-fat diet that can help you lose weight, improve your health, and boost your energy levels. But to reap these benefits, you need a structured plan, and that's where the 21-day plan in Chiquis Keto comes in. This plan provides daily meal plans that adhere to the principles of the keto diet, ensuring you get the right balance of fats, proteins, and carbohydrates. Following a structured plan like this can take the guesswork out of dieting and help you stay on track. But a plan is only as good as your ability to execute it, and that's where preparation comes in. Chiquis Keto provides shopping lists to help you prepare in advance. These lists can help you avoid the confusion and stress that can come with shopping for a new diet. With a shopping list in hand, you can confidently navigate the grocery store aisles and fill your cart with keto-friendly foods. Once you've got your groceries, it's time to prepare your meals. Meal prep is a crucial part of maintaining a diet, and Chiquis Keto provides tips to help you save time and reduce stress. For example, the book suggests preparing meals in bulk and storing them in the fridge or freezer. This ensures that you always have a healthy, keto-friendly meal on hand, even when you're too busy or tired to cook. Of course, starting a new diet isn't always smooth sailing. You might face challenges, like dealing with cravings or staying motivated. But Chiquis Keto offers advice on how to handle these challenges. For example, the book suggests finding keto-friendly alternatives to your favorite foods, so you can satisfy your cravings without breaking your diet. It also emphasizes the importance of resilience and perseverance. Remember, it's okay to have setbacks. What matters is that you get back on track. Finally, Chiquis Keto encourages you to view the keto diet as a sustainable lifestyle change, rather than a short-term fix. The book provides strategies for maintaining the diet in the long term, such as incorporating regular exercise and making mindful eating a habit. By adopting these strategies, you can make the keto diet a part of your everyday life, rather than a temporary solution. In conclusion, starting a keto diet doesn't have to be a daunting task.
